THREE conservation areas in Lymm are set to merge.
The borough council feels it can manage the areas of Lymm Village Centre, Eagle Brow and New Road better if they become one larger one.
Conservation areas are used to preserve areas of special architectural or historic interest by forcing planners to meet the strictest guidelines before building or destroying buildings.
